ISHS Acta Horticulturae 270: I International Symposium on Horticultural Economics in Developing Countries

ECONOMIC EFFICIENCY OF COTTON PRODUCTION AT THE MIDDLE AWASH STATE FARMS OF ETHIOPIA

Author:   G. Ayele
Abstract:
This study was conducted at the Middle Awash Cotton Producing State Farms of ethiopia with the major objective of assessing the economic performance and efficiency of the farms. The result has confirmed that the farms under the study are not only financial losers but some are found to be wasteful by the criteria of economic efficiency. Indeed, it was the second major finding of the study that the resource utilization of the farms investigated are far from being optimal. This suggests that with a more rational use and factor productivity at hand financial and economic returns would have been considerably higher than they are now even with the existing pricing policy.
